Code · California · Penal Code

§ 2811

(a)Commencing July 1, 2005, the director shall adopt and maintain a compensation schedule for inmate employees. That compensation schedule shall be based on quantity and quality of work performed and shall be required for its performance, but in no event shall that compensation exceed one-half the minimum wage provided in Section 1182 of the Labor Code, except as otherwise provided in this code. This compensation shall be credited to the account of the inmate.
(b)Inmate compensation shall be paid from the California Correctional Training and Rehabilitation Revolving Fund.
